The Define Phase is a fixed-price scoping engagement following Discovery in which Hello World produces a detailed implementation plan, technical architecture, and confirmed build budget — converting strategic direction into an executable build.
What Define produces
- Detailed scope with prioritized feature list.
- Information architecture and content model.
- Technical architecture: hosting, frameworks, integrations, third-party services.
- Wireframes for key flows.
- Project plan with phased milestones.
- Fixed-price build budget you can take to your board or finance team.
Why a separate phase
Quoting a fixed price for a complex build without Define would either over-quote (to cover unknowns) or under-quote (and force change orders later). Define removes the unknowns. You finish Define with the confidence to commit to a build, the cost to do it, and the option to take the plan in-house.
Typical length and cost
Two to four weeks of focused work with a small Hello World team and a few hours per week of your team’s time. Cost typically ranges from $10K to $30K depending on project complexity.
